Alaska Supreme Court

City of Soldotna v. State of Alaska, Local Boundary Commission

September 27, 2024556 P.3d 1158

Summary

The Alaska Supreme Court affirmed the Superior Court’s judgment upholding the Local Boundary Commission’s decision to convert the City of Soldotna’s annexation petition from legislative review to local action, finding the Commission acted within its statutory authority, the regulation was valid, no rulemaking was required, the decision was supported by a reasonable basis, and any procedural omission was harmless error.
